INTRODUCTION
McCarter & English invites applications for the McCarter & English Pro Bono Fellowship for the City of Newark, New Jersey. The Fellowship is a unique opportunity for an attorney to dedicate their time on providing legal services for the benefit of the Newark community. The Fellow is a key member of the Firm’s thriving pro bono program in Newark, reporting to the Pro Bono Partner and the Newark Office Managing Partner and working closely with partners throughout the Firm. The salary for this position is $95,000 annually. Candidates who receive an offer of employment will be processed through a background check which will be an individualized assessment based on the applicant’s or employee’s specific record and the duties and requirements of the specific job.
The Fellowship focuses on the rights and unmet legal needs of low-income individuals and families residing in Newark, with a particular emphasis on housing. While the position is primarily litigation focused, there are opportunities for the Fellow to develop and participate in a variety of broad-based advocacy strategies to drive public policy and increase services to the people and communities this position is intended to serve. Past Fellows have represented pro bono clients at hearings, trials, immigration interviews, and settlement negotiations; conducted know-your-rights presentations and trainings for community members; served as amicus counsel in appellate proceedings; conducted research to inform systemic reform advocacy; and engaged in public speaking and community education.
This is a two-year full-time attorney position, with the next term commencing in October 2026 and running through September 2028. The Fellow receives a competitive public interest salary with the benefits that are available to Firm associates. The Fellow is fully integrated into Firm life, including trainings, social interactions, and the full range of professional development opportunities available to associates.
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
Candidates must demonstrate a strong commitment to public interest law and practice. Judicial clerkships and fluency in Spanish or other languages commonly spoken in Newark are preferred. Candidates should also demonstrate excellent research, writing, and interpersonal skills, including the ability to convey complex legal concepts to a non-lawyer audience. The ideal candidate will have a strong connection and commitment to the City of Newark. Admission to the New Jersey bar is required within six months.

How to Get Visa Sponsorship in McCarter & English Visa Sponsorship USA
Target practice groups with high associate demand
McCarter & English's litigation, corporate, and intellectual property groups tend to drive associate hiring. Focus your outreach on these practice areas, where firms historically have the most consistent need for sponsored talent at the associate level.
Understand that law firm H-1B sponsorship is selective
Large law firms sponsor H-1B visas, but typically for roles requiring a JD or highly specialized legal expertise. Make sure your background clearly maps to a billable role, general business or operations positions are far less likely to be sponsored.
Time your application around law firm recruiting cycles
McCarter & English follows structured associate and lateral hiring cycles. Fall on-campus recruiting targets law students, while lateral hiring runs year-round. Knowing which cycle fits your situation helps you approach the firm at the right moment.

Prepare for nonimmigrant intent questions in legal interviews
Law firms sponsoring H-1B visas are acutely aware of immigration compliance. Be ready to clearly articulate your visa status, timeline, and any transition plans. Demonstrating you understand the process builds confidence with hiring partners reviewing your candidacy.
Leverage bar admission and clerkship experience as differentiators
McCarter & English, like most Am Law firms, prioritizes candidates with strong academic credentials, bar admission in relevant states, and judicial clerkship experience. These credentials directly strengthen a sponsorship case by demonstrating specialized legal qualification for the role.

Does McCarter & English sponsor H-1B visas?
Yes, McCarter & English sponsors H-1B visas. The firm has an active sponsorship track record within the legal services industry, primarily supporting attorneys and legal professionals in roles that require specialized expertise. If you're a visa-dependent candidate targeting the firm, H-1B is the primary pathway to focus on during your application process.
What types of roles at McCarter & English are most likely to receive visa sponsorship?
Sponsorship at McCarter & English is concentrated in attorney-track roles, particularly associates in practice groups like litigation, corporate, and intellectual property. These positions require a JD and bar admission, which satisfies the specialty occupation standard for H-1B purposes. Non-attorney or general administrative roles are significantly less likely to qualify for sponsorship.

What is the typical application and sponsorship timeline at a firm like McCarter & English?
For fall on-campus recruiting, the process runs August through October with offers extended shortly after callback interviews. Lateral hiring timelines vary but typically span four to eight weeks from first interview to offer. H-1B sponsorship itself adds several months after an offer is accepted, since the employer must file the petition before your start date, timing matters significantly if you're transitioning from OPT or another status.
Does McCarter & English sponsor F-1 OPT or TN visa holders?
McCarter & English has sponsored candidates on F-1 OPT, which means international law graduates working under post-graduation work authorization may be considered for roles while the firm pursues longer-term H-1B sponsorship. TN status is available to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ying roles. If you hold either status, it's worth discussing your situation directly with the recruiting team early in the process to confirm sponsorship feasibility.
